Why knowledge_query_outcomes needs a policy

This tool retrieves and analyzes historical outcome event data from the GitHub Projects V2 workflow. The use of 'query' combined with 'find patterns in pipeline history' indicates a read-only operation that aggregates existing data without side effects. No mutations, deletions, code execution, or financial operations are described, making this a straightforward Read classification with low severity.

Can I rate-limit knowledge_query_outcomes?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the knowledge_query_outcomes r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block knowledge_query_outcomes complet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for knowledge_query_outcomes.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
